Synbiotic Avian is an ideal daily supplement designed to support the digestive and immune systems, as well as aid during periods of intestinal dysfunction such as diarrhoea or malabsorption.
Key Features:
- 550 million CFU/g concentration of beneficial bacteria ensures optimal immune and digestive support.
- Natural prebiotic chicory root extract feeds and nourishes beneficial bacteria, boosting immune strength.
- Digestive enzymes enhance food digestion, especially beneficial for animals recovering from stress and injury.
- Unique 9 strains of beneficial bacteria combined with prebiotics and digestive enzymes.

Dosage Guidelines:
Maintenance Dose (Daily Use):
- Water: Add 1g of Synbiotic to 1L of clean drinking water.
- Food: Add 3g of Synbiotic to 1kg of dry food, soft food, vegetables, hand rearing formula, etc.
Stress Dose (Post-antibiotics or during digestive upset):
- Water: Add 2g of Synbiotic to 1L of clean drinking water.
- Food: Add 6g of Synbiotic to 1kg of dry food, soft food, hand rearing formula, etc.
Storage:
- Store below 25°C (air conditioning).
- Keep the container tightly closed to maintain freshness.
Expiry:
- 2 years from date of manufacture.
Active Constituents:
-
Probiotics:
- Lactobacillus acidophilus, L. casei, L. salivarius, L. plantarum, L. rhamnosus, L. brevis, Bifidobacterium bifidum, B. lactis, S. thermophilus
-
Prebiotic:
- Inulin (Chicory Root Extract)
-
Enzymes:
- Protease, Amylase, Cellulase, Hemicellulase, Lipase, Papain, Bromelain
